Things We Can Be Thankful For.....
I AM THANKFUL FOR THE TEENAGER WHO IS NOT
DOING DISHES BUT IS WATCHING TV,
BECAUSE THAT MEANS HE IS AT HOME AND NOT ON
THE STREETS.

FOR THE TAXES THAT I PAY, BECAUSE IT MEANS
THAT I AM EMPLOYED.

FOR THE MESS TO CLEAN AFTER A PARTY, BECAUSE
IT MEANS THAT I HAVE BEEN
SURROUNDED BY FRIENDS.

FOR THE CLOTHES THAT FIT A LITTLE TOO SNUG,
BECAUSE IT MEANS I HAVE
ENOUGH TO EAT.

FOR MY SHADOW THAT WATCHES ME WORK, BECAUSE IT
MEANS I AM OUT IN THE SUNSHINE.

FOR A LAWN THAT NEEDS MOWING, WINDOWS THAT
NEED CLEANING, AND GUTTERS THAT
NEED FIXING, BECAUSE IT MEANS I HAVE A HOME.

FOR ALL THE COMPLAINING I HEAR ABOUT THE
GOVERNMENT, BECAUSE IT MEANS
THAT WE HAVE FREEDOM OF SPEECH.

FOR THE PARKING SPOT I FIND AT THE FAR END OF
THE PARKING LOT, BECAUSE IT
MEANS I AM CAPABLE OF WALKING AND THAT I HAVE
BEEN BLESSED WITH TRANSPORTATION.

FOR MY HUGE HEATING BILL, BECAUSE IT MEANS I
AM WARM.

FOR THE LADY BEHIND ME IN CHURCH THAT SINGS
OFF KEY, BECAUSE IT MEANS
THAT I CAN HEAR.

FOR THE PILE OF LAUNDRY AND IRONING, BECAUSE
IT MEANS I HAVE CLOTHES TO WEAR.

FOR WEARINESS AND ACHING MUSCLES AT THE END OF
THE DAY, BECAUSE IT MEANS
I HAVE BEEN CAPABLE OF WORKING HARD.

FOR THE ALARM THAT GOES OF IN THE EARLY
MORNING HOURS, BECAUSE IT
MEANS THAT I AM ALIVE.
AND FINALLY.......FOR TOO MUCH E-MAIL, BECAUSE
IT MEANS I HAVE FRIENDS
WHO ARE THINKING OF ME.
